Trigger Guardearly 17th century.  Several examples of this particular shape of trigger guard were recovered from Jordan's Journey near Hopewell in Prince George Countytwo from the same pit including this one and trigger guard 1143.  A third example of exactly the same shape as this one came from another nearby feature on the same site (not illustrated here).
